none
Reportes en SP2010 RRS feed

  • Pregunta

  • Alquien tiene algunos tips o algo que me pueda ayudar con la tarea de generación de reportes en sharepoint, reportes con gráficos de barras o el gráfico de torta? claro esta que no se realicen mediante excel? ideas??? PerformancePoint? Reporting Services? algun otro????
    jueves, 24 de febrero de 2011 15:25

Respuestas

  • Hola DarkMA,

    Te cuento:

    • Si optas por SQL Server Reporting Services, tienes bastantes tipos de orígenes de datos en los que basar tu informe: SQL Server, SQL Azure, Analysis Services, XML...si además trabajas con SharePoint 2010 sobre SQL Server 2008 R2, tienes la posibilidad de  usar un tipo de origen Lista de SharePoint. En el caso de que trabajes con SharePoint 2007, también tienes la posibilidad de usar listas de SharePoint eligiendo XML como tipo de origen de datos y trabajando con los servicios web.
    • En el caso de PerformancePoint también tienes varios tipos de orígenes de datos soportados, pero en la parte de informes casi te diría que la opción es Analysis Services.

    Te dejo dos ejemplos de Reporting Services con listas de SharePoint:

    • SharePoint 2010: http://technet.microsoft.com/es-es/library/ff519559.aspx y http://jcgonzalezmartin.wordpress.com/2011/01/26/sharepoint-2010-como-crear-un-informe-de-ssrs-a-partir-de-una-lista-de-sharepoint-con-parmetros/
    • SharePoint 2007:http://geeks.ms/blogs/ciin/archive/2008/12/10/sharepoint-y-ssrs-2008-iv.aspx
    Saludos!
    jueves, 24 de febrero de 2011 16:47
    • Marcado como respuesta Uriel Almendra miércoles, 3 de abril de 2013 17:37
    miércoles, 2 de marzo de 2011 13:32

Todas las respuestas

  • Hola DarkSMA,

    Pues depende de lo que quieras hacer:

    • Reporting Services te permite crear gráficos de barras y de tarta.
    • PerformancePoint también te permite este tipo de gráficos, pero con capacidad analítica ya que se basarán en cubos de analysis services.
    Saludos!
    jueves, 24 de febrero de 2011 15:28
  • Gracias por la respuesta...

    Aer suponiendo que utilizo reporting services, entonces, los reportes que puedo generar son desde que almacen de datos? imagino que alguna tabla de alguna base de datos en especial MSQL o pudiese utilizar información almacenada en toda la plataforma del SP??? gracias por la ayuda...!!

    jueves, 24 de febrero de 2011 15:39
  • Hola DarkMA,

    Te cuento:

    • Si optas por SQL Server Reporting Services, tienes bastantes tipos de orígenes de datos en los que basar tu informe: SQL Server, SQL Azure, Analysis Services, XML...si además trabajas con SharePoint 2010 sobre SQL Server 2008 R2, tienes la posibilidad de  usar un tipo de origen Lista de SharePoint. En el caso de que trabajes con SharePoint 2007, también tienes la posibilidad de usar listas de SharePoint eligiendo XML como tipo de origen de datos y trabajando con los servicios web.
    • En el caso de PerformancePoint también tienes varios tipos de orígenes de datos soportados, pero en la parte de informes casi te diría que la opción es Analysis Services.

    Te dejo dos ejemplos de Reporting Services con listas de SharePoint:

    • SharePoint 2010: http://technet.microsoft.com/es-es/library/ff519559.aspx y http://jcgonzalezmartin.wordpress.com/2011/01/26/sharepoint-2010-como-crear-un-informe-de-ssrs-a-partir-de-una-lista-de-sharepoint-con-parmetros/
    • SharePoint 2007:http://geeks.ms/blogs/ciin/archive/2008/12/10/sharepoint-y-ssrs-2008-iv.aspx
    Saludos!
    jueves, 24 de febrero de 2011 16:47
  • Gracias por la respuesta Juan, disculpa por la molestia pero el primer enlace no es correcto, me dirijo a la URL y pues sale el mensaje de Página no solicitada. espero puedas volvera a publicar por que es la que, si mal no me equivoco, me ayudará saludos...!!
    jueves, 24 de febrero de 2011 17:17
  • jajaja disculpa un lapsus corchus asnus de mi parte :S perdon...!!
    jueves, 24 de febrero de 2011 17:20
  • Segun veo necesito un Report Server para poder hacer los reportes??
    jueves, 24 de febrero de 2011 18:58
  • Hola DarkSMA,

    Correcto, para los informes de Reporting Services necesitas tener el componente de Reporting Services de SQL Server configurado en modo integrado con SharePoint...en mi blog puedes encontrar información sobre como hacerlo.

    Saludos!

    jueves, 24 de febrero de 2011 19:24
  • Gracias Juan, disculpa si no fuera molestia podrías compartirme el enlace para donde esta la información de como hacerlo? te estaría muy agradecido, saludos...!!
    viernes, 25 de febrero de 2011 14:31
  • Aer sangoogleando encontre información y pues tambien en tu sitio, pasa que ya lo tengo configurado, como lo se? pues al menos esta vez si me permite visualizar un reporte que hice en VS y lo subi. Pero ahora cuando quiero hacer un reporte desde Report Builder no puedo conectarme a ninguna lista de SP y no se porque es el problema.
    viernes, 25 de febrero de 2011 16:00
  • Hola DarkSMA,

    Pues si visualizas el informe, tienes configurado SSRS como bien dices integrado con SharePoint...para conectarte a la lista, ¿especificas las credenciales de acceso al crear la cadena de conexión?

    http://geeks.ms/blogs/ciin/archive/2011/01/26/sharepoint-2010-como-crear-un-informe-de-ssrs-a-partir-de-una-lista-de-sharepoint-con-par-225-metros.aspx

    Saludos!

    viernes, 25 de febrero de 2011 16:52
  • Hola DarkSMA,

    Estuve trabajando bastante con SSRS 2008 R2 y Report Builder 3.0 ultimamente. Funciona muy bien. Te dejo algunos artículo en donde documente algunos temas que te pueden ser útil:

     

    No dejes de leer los artículo de Juan Carlos, que es un especialista.
    Otro artículo que me sirvió mucho de Report Builder 2.0, pero muy aplicable a RB 3 es:

    http://download.microsoft.com/download/A/D/4/AD4F3667-B5CB-4022-ABBB-1FA3BF55B786/SSRS_RB2_Authoring_Reports_Quickstart%20Guide_020609.docx

    Espero que todo esto te sirva si vas por Report Builder.
    Saludos!

     


    Juan Pablo.
    surpoint.blogspot.com
    jpussacq.me
    @jpussacq
    lunes, 28 de febrero de 2011 19:43
  • Muchas gracias por las respuestas, pues ya he instalado y configurado, tenía solo un tonto problema de credenciales pero sigo con los inconvenientes, no puedo hacer un reporte desde dos listas y esto esta siendo una limitante a la hora de trabajar ya que me convendría mucho poder "interceptar" dos listas y pues ni son el SSRS 2008 ni con Reporting service puedo hacer esta tarea.... saludos
    martes, 1 de marzo de 2011 13:20
  • Hola DarkSMA,

    Ese es otro problema...cuando creas informes de SSRS a partir de listas de SharePoint sólo tienes la posibilidad de usar una única lista...por defecto sólo tienes esa opción por lo que tendrás que pensar en una alternativa para tener disponibles los datos que necesitas de las dos listas para construir el informe.

    Saludos!

    martes, 1 de marzo de 2011 22:53
  • jaja si px problema problema, gueno estare pensando en alguna solución gracias
    miércoles, 2 de marzo de 2011 13:28
  • Hola DarkSMA:

     

    Lo que te voy a decir no lo he probado desde Reporting Services, peor tal vez ayude. En SharePoint 2010 cuando defines una columna lookup puedes seleccionar otro campos para heredar desde la tabla padre (no sólo uno como en 2007). Quizá (y sólo si aplica a tu caso) esto pueda evitarte hacer el join.

    Saludos!


    Juan Pablo.
    surpoint.blogspot.com
    jpussacq.me
    @jpussacq
    miércoles, 2 de marzo de 2011 13:31
    • Marcado como respuesta Uriel Almendra miércoles, 3 de abril de 2013 17:37
    miércoles, 2 de marzo de 2011 13:32